An instrumental method for the rapid determination of total mesophilic bacteria and total coliforms in hamburgers is described. The two procedures are based on the gas chromatographic determination of metabolic CO 2 in equilibrium in the head space of sealed vials containing suitable media and inoculated with aliquots of the sample under examination. Both procedures proved to be suitable for quality control of meat products, being highly sensitive, reproducible, simple and rapid. Good correlation coefficients were obtained with plate counting for microbial concentrations ranging between 10 1 and 10 8 .
